Types of Licensing Agreements Supporting Open Innovation

Various licensing agreements support open innovation by enabling collaboration, knowledge sharing, and technology transfer. Among these, patent licensing allows holders to license inventions to third parties, fostering broader development and commercialization.

Cross-licensing agreements enable mutual access to each other’s patent portfolios, promoting synergy and reducing litigation risks. This arrangement facilitates open access while safeguarding proprietary rights.

Additionally, open source licenses such as the GNU General Public License (GPL) or Apache License promote collaborative development by allowing free use, modification, and distribution of software. These agreements significantly support open innovation within technology ecosystems.

Standard licensing agreements, including exclusive or non-exclusive licenses, provide flexible options that accommodate varying strategic goals. They encourage partnerships and extend market reach, supporting broader innovation networks.

Open Source Licensing and Its Impact

Open source licensing is a legal framework that permits users to freely access, modify, and distribute software or innovations under specified conditions. This form of licensing promotes transparency and collaboration, fueling open innovation ecosystems.

The impact of open source licensing is profound, as it lowers barriers to entry for developers and organizations. It accelerates innovation by enabling shared improvements and collective problem-solving within a community.

By adopting open source licensing models, companies can foster interoperability and drive technological advancement. These licenses, such as the GNU General Public License or MIT License, encourage licensing and open innovation by clearly delineating rights and responsibilities, thereby reducing legal uncertainties.

Industry Examples and Best Practices

Successful licensing strategies in open innovation are exemplified by leading industry practices. For example, Qualcomm’s licensing model has fostered extensive collaboration within the telecommunications sector, encouraging innovation through broad patent licensing agreements. This approach demonstrates how strategic licensing can drive technological advancement.

In the pharmaceutical industry, companies like Merck have employed licensing agreements to share compounds and research tools with academia and biotech firms. This facilitates open innovation while protecting intellectual property rights, leading to accelerated drug development and market entry.

Tech giants such as Microsoft and IBM also exemplify best practices by adopting open licensing frameworks for open source projects. This promotes collaborative software development, resulting in more rapid innovation cycles and community-driven improvements. These practices showcase the balance of licensing and open innovation to sustain industry growth.
